Nah, I just picked a few with the shortest repayment term. If the loan has been actually allocated a month or more before you choose it, then one with a 6 month repayment term can end up being fully repaid in under 5 months.

Doesn't really matter, short term or long term, I just wanted a few to be turning over. Actually for people in the poorest countries or where the loan is for seasonal agriculture or stock raising a longer term loan may actually be more helpful. Depends on the circumstances and your viewpoint, at first I believed that shorter term loans were a better idea as they minimised the total interest being charged to borrowers but then I realised that a longer loan term meant that a larger amount could be borrowed or each monthly repayment could be less. Now I alternate between picking one myself which is usually shorter term and using autopick which often chooses a longer term one for me.
